DTC P1120 - STARTER SWITCH CIRCUIT HIGH INPUT

DTC DETECTING CONDITION:
- Two consecutive driving cycles with fault

TROUBLE SYMPTOM:
- Failure of engine to start

CAUTION: After repair or replacement of faulty parts, conduct CLEAR MEMORY MODE and INSPECTION MODE. Refer to How to Clear Diagnostic Trouble Codes. Clear Memory Mode




WIRING DIAGRAM

10BU1: CHECK OPERATION OF STARTER MOTOR.

NOTE:
- ON AT vehicles, place the inhibitor switch in each position.
- On MT vehicles, depress or release the clutch pedal.

CHECK: Does starter motor operate when ignition switch to "ON"?

YES: Repair battery short circuit in starter motor circuit. After repair, replace ECM.

NO: Check starter motor circuit.
